Off-the-beaten-path travel opens up a realm of possibilities, from quaint villages nestled in the mountains to remote beaches untouched by mass tourism. These hidden gems often possess their own charm, history, and culture, waiting to be explored. For instance, instead of the bustling streets of Barcelona, travelers might find joy in the picturesque village of Cadaqués, where vibrant Mediterranean colors and a laid-back atmosphere reign supreme. Here, visitors can stroll along cobblestone streets, enjoy fresh seafood at local eateries, and take in breathtaking views of the coast.

Exploring lesser-known destinations also allows travelers to experience cultures in their most authentic forms. In places like Bhutan, for example, tourism is regulated to preserve its rich traditions and stunning landscapes. Here, visitors can immerse themselves in the local way of life, from participating in traditional festivals to trekking through pristine valleys. This connection to local customs enriches the travel experience, fostering a sense of appreciation and understanding that often eludes those who stick to the well-trodden path.

Another benefit of venturing off the beaten path is the opportunity to support local economies. Small businesses in lesser-known areas often rely heavily on tourism, and by choosing to visit these destinations, travelers contribute directly to the livelihoods of local families. Whether it’s staying in a family-run guesthouse, dining at a locally owned restaurant, or purchasing handmade crafts from artisans, every choice can help sustain communities. This positive impact can be incredibly rewarding, creating a sense of purpose behind the travel experience.

Culinary experiences also flourish in off-the-beaten-path locations. Travelers can discover regional specialties that are not typically found in more touristy areas. For instance, sampling traditional dishes made from locally sourced ingredients allows visitors to savor the true flavors of a region. In the markets of Fez, Morocco, travelers can enjoy aromatic tagines and fresh mint tea while mingling with locals, experiencing the vibrant food culture that often goes unnoticed in larger cities.

Adventurous travelers can also engage in activities that promote a deeper understanding of the natural world. For example, eco-tourism initiatives in places like Madagascar allow visitors to participate in conservation efforts while exploring unique ecosystems. Travelers can join guided tours to observe lemurs in their natural habitat or volunteer in projects that protect endangered species. These experiences foster a sense of responsibility and connection to the environment, encouraging travelers to become advocates for preservation.

Travelers should also keep in mind the importance of responsible travel when venturing into lesser-known areas. Respecting local customs, minimizing waste, and being mindful of environmental impact are essential practices that contribute to sustainable tourism. Engaging with locals in a respectful manner, such as learning a few phrases in the local language or participating in cultural traditions, can greatly enhance the travel experience.
